Are detachable bumpers necessary?

Do the bumpers need to be detached (for the inspection process) or can they be fixed? I know about color switching and that's not a huge issue for us, but what's necessary is questioning whether we need to remove the plywood during the inspection process, when they're weighing the robot. Re: Are detachable bumpers necessary?

They need to be weighed separately, which require the bumper to be removed at least that one time.

Even if they are reversible bumpers

yes the wood is part of the bumper assembly and needs to be removed with it.

Re: Are detachable bumpers necessary?

Yes, and no.

In theory, if your bumpers are not detachable, there are ways around it (such as measuring the Frame Perimeter). If you have reversible bumpers, then changing your color between matches should not be a problem.

One area that will be a problem is weighing your robot. If your bumpers are not detachable, then they would have a presumed weight of 0 pounds, and your robot WITH bumpers must meet the 120 pound weight limit.

One possible solution:

Go to weigh in with your bumpers off. They will get your weight and frame perimeter at that time. Put your bumpers on for your inspection. I don't think the RI's need to ask you to take your bumpers off for inspection. The inspection checklist does not ask the RI's to verify how fast you can remove/attach bumpers. It does ask that RI's verify that it can display red/blue. If you have reversible bumpers, then that would be an easy question. If you don't, then you will have to demonstrate that you can change colors relatively quickly.

Re: Are detachable bumpers necessary?

Emphasis mine:
Quote:
Originally Posted by R25
BUMPERS (the entire BUMPER, not just the cover) must be designed for quick and easy installation and removal to facilitate inspection and weighing.
As a guideline, BUMPERS should be able to be installed or removed by two (2) people in fewer than five (5) minutes.
Seems pretty clear.

Re: Are detachable bumpers necessary?

The point of quickly removable bumper is to allow fast turn around between matches. If you can change colors without removing the bumpers then there is flexibility on how fast you can take off your bumpers, but they do need to be readily removable. You will be expected to weigh the robot separately from the bumpers during inspection and possibly during re-inspection.

Re: Are detachable bumpers necessary?

On top of what has already been mentioned, please consider how your robot will fit through doorways with bumpers on. There are multiple events (especially districts) where you will have to fit through a regular door. There may also be post season impacts if you're using your robot for demos. Being able to pull your bumpers off isn't only legally required, you may want to be able to do it quickly and easily for transportation.
